Sadržaj:

Kako da odobrim privilegiju korisnika u Oracle-u?
Kako da odobrim privilegiju korisnika u Oracle-u?

Video: Kako da odobrim privilegiju korisnika u Oracle-u?

Video: Kako da odobrim privilegiju korisnika u Oracle-u?
Video: 5 pasos para la integración digital de la empresa 2024, Maj
Anonim

Kako kreirati korisnika i dodijeliti dozvole u Oracleu

  1. STVORITI USER books_admin IDENTIFIKOVANO OD MyPassword;
  2. GRANT POVEŽI SE NA books_admin;
  3. GRANT CONNECT, RESOURCE, DBA TO books_admin;
  4. GRANT CREATE SESSION GRANT BILO PRIVILEGE TO books_admin;
  5. GRANT NEOGRANIČEN TABLESPACE TO books_admin;
  6. GRANT SELECT, INSERT, UPDATE, DELETE NA šemi. knjige TO books_admin;

Što je s opcijom granta u Oracleu?

The WITH OPCIJA GRANT klauzula. Vlasnik objekta može grant drugom korisniku navođenjem WITH GRANT OPTION klauzula u GRANT izjava. U ovom slučaju, novi primalac može tada grant isti nivo pristupa drugim korisnicima ili ulogama.

kako daješ dozvole u SQL-u? SQL Grant komanda je navikla obezbediti pristup ili privilegije na objekte baze podataka korisnicima. Sintaksa za GRANT komanda je: GRANT privilege_name ON object_name TO {user_name | JAVNO | ime_uloge} [sa GRANT opcija]; Ovdje privilege_name: je pristup pravo ili privilegija odobreno korisniku.

Jednostavno, kako provjeriti da li korisnik ima pristup tabeli u Oracle-u?

To odrediti koji korisnici imaju direktni grant pristup stolu koristićemo pogled DBA_TAB_PRIVS: SELECT * FROM DBA_TAB_PRIVS; Možeš provjeriti službenu dokumentaciju za više informacija o stupcima vraćenim iz ovog upita, ali kritični stupci su: GRANTEE je ime korisnik sa odobrenim pristup.

Šta je resurs Grant povezivanja korisniku u Oracleu?

The RESOURCE uloga grantovi a korisnik privilegije potrebne za kreiranje procedura, okidača i, u Oracle8, tipova unutar korisnika vlastito područje šeme. Odobrenje a korisnik RESOURCE bez CONNECT , dok je moguće, ne dozvoljava korisnik da se prijavite u bazu podataka.

Preporučuje se: